I use Ballistol Universal Aero for this (I don't know if it's available in the US).
It dissolves rust well, is harmless to the human body and is an antiseptic. I always process all the purchased old knives with it.

Theo wrote: ↑Sat Jan 07, 2023 7:54 pm
Posted this yesterday I believe, Camillus Sword Streamline four liner I got on the bay
Nice old Streamline ! Would pop those celluloid covers off before the brass liners are junk ! Have several of these and the covers out gas so bad they will ruin other knives if close by . The covers have 4 little tabs holding them on and pop off easily.
